youmengting-dev
游梦婷 1 year ago
parent db7ac9e500
commit f185fccb68
  1. 68
      common/share.js
  2. 12
      pages/welcome/welcome.vue

@ -49,49 +49,49 @@ export default {
] // 必填,需要使用的JS接口列表,所有JS接口列表见附录2 ] // 必填,需要使用的JS接口列表,所有JS接口列表见附录2
}); });
/* configreadyconfig /* configreadyconfig
config是一个客户端的异步操作所以如果需要在页面加载时就调用相关接口则须把相关接口放在ready函数中调用来确保正确执行 config是一个客户端的异步操作所以如果需要在页面加载时就调用相关接口则须把相关接口放在ready函数中调用来确保正确执行
对于用户触发时才调用的接口则可以直接调用不需要放在ready函数中 */ 对于用户触发时才调用的接口则可以直接调用不需要放在ready函数中 */
wx.ready(function() { //需在用户可能点击分享按钮前就先调用 wx.ready(function() { //需在用户可能点击分享按钮前就先调用
/* 分享给朋友 */ /* 分享给朋友 */
wx.updateAppMessageShareData({ wx.updateAppMessageShareData({
title: '嗨森逛分享', // 分享标题 title: '嗨森逛分享', // 分享标题
// desc: '', // 分享描述 // desc: '', // 分享描述
link: that.shareLink, // 分享链接 link: that.shareLink, // 分享链接
imgUrl: 'https://hsg.dctpay.com/filesystem/wxApplets/logo.png', // 分享图标 imgUrl: 'https://hsg.dctpay.com/filesystem/wxApplets/logo.png', // 分享图标
success: function(res) { success: function(res) {
// 支付成功后的回调函数 // 回调函数
uni.showToast({ // uni.showToast({
title: '分享成功', // title: '分享成功',
duration: 2000, // duration: 2000,
icon: 'none' // icon: 'none'
}) // })
}, },
cancel: function(r) {}, cancel: function(r) {},
fail: function(res) {} fail: function(res) {}
}); });
/* 自定义“分享到朋友圈” */ /* 自定义“分享到朋友圈” */
wx.updateTimelineShareData({ wx.updateTimelineShareData({
title: '嗨森逛分享', // 分享标题 title: '嗨森逛分享', // 分享标题
// desc: '', // 分享描述 // desc: '', // 分享描述
link: that.shareLink, // 分享链接 link: that.shareLink, // 分享链接
imgUrl: 'https://hsg.dctpay.com/filesystem/wxApplets/logo.png', // 分享图标 imgUrl: 'https://hsg.dctpay.com/filesystem/wxApplets/logo.png', // 分享图标
success: function(res) { success: function(res) {
// 支付成功后的回调函数
uni.showToast({ // uni.showToast({
title: '分享成功', // title: '分享成功',
duration: 2000, // duration: 2000,
icon: 'none' // icon: 'none'
}) // })
}, },
cancel: function(r) {}, cancel: function(r) {},
fail: function(res) {} fail: function(res) {}
}); });
}); });
// wx.error(function(res) { // wx.error(function(res) {

@ -113,10 +113,14 @@
return return
} }
uni.navigateTo({ if(value != "/"){
url: value uni.navigateTo({
}) url: value
return; })
return;
}
} }
uni.switchTab({ uni.switchTab({

Loading…
Cancel
Save